About The Position

Marki Microwave Equipment Engineering Technicians are responsible for supporting production and development staff with operation, maintenance, and programming of various manufacturing equipment. This is an entry-level position. We hire for attitude and aptitude and develop the technical skills on the job.

Responsibilities

  • Perform set up, calibration, maintenance, and troubleshooting of basic production equipment including but not limited to: microscopes, hot plates, ovens, hand tools, pneumatic hoses, paint guns, soldering irons, torque wrenches, etc.
  • Track & perform preventative maintenance & calibration schedules for production, reliability, & test equipment
  • Order equipment, tooling, maintenance supplies, replacement parts etc.
  • Coordinate with repairmen and vendors for scheduling maintenance, repairs, and calibration.
  • Train machine & equipment operators on new and current processes as assigned.
  • Cross train fellow Technicians on current equipment operation, programming, & troubleshooting
  • Create operator procedures for new processes and machinery.
  • Utilize, update, and maintain 2D CAD for drawing referencing
  • Assist Machine Operators in operating production equipment & programming automation equipment for similar products
  • Assist Engineering staff in production and prototyping of products including running experiments, testing, tuning, proto building, reflow, etc.
  • Assist in equipment maintenance to help ensure upkeep of capital equipment for production and R&D
  • Perform basic electrical tests under the guidance of engineering or technician staff
  • Work with small hand tools, tweezers, and fixtures
  • Troubleshoot programming issues on automation equipment
  • Use Microsoft office to track PM schedules, create presentations, document processes, etc.
  • Communicate with cross-functional team members and management via written or verbal formats
